On Tuesday, February 4, 2025 5:50 PM, Fijalkowski, Maciej <maciej.fijalkowski@xxxxxxxxx> wrote:
>On Tue, Feb 04, 2025 at 08:49:06AM +0800, Song Yoong Siang wrote:
>> Refactor the code for inserting an empty packet into a new function
>> igc_insert_empty_packet(). This change extracts the logic for inserting
>> an empty packet from igc_xmit_frame_ring() into a separate function,
>> allowing it to be reused in future implementations, such as the XDP
>> zero copy transmit function.
>>
>> This patch introduces no functional changes.

>shouldn't this be 'goto drop' from day 1? pretty weird to silently ignore
>allocation error.
>
Hi Fijalkowski Maciej,
Thanks for your comments.
"insert an empty packet" is a launch time trick to send a packet in
next Qbv cycle. The design is, the driver will still sending the
packet, even the empty packet insertion trick is fail (unable to
allocate). The intention of this patch set is to enable launch time
on XDP zero-copy data path, so I try not to change the original
behavior of launch time.
btw, do you think driver should drop the packet if something went
wrong with the launch time, like launch time offload not enabled,
launch time over horizon, empty packet insertion fail, etc?
If yes, then maybe i can submit another patch to change the behavior
of launch time and we can continue to discuss there.
